    Just to clarify it is not possible to seam tape a silnylon tent. You can seamseal it, and you can use yarn that swell up when wet and seals the needle punctures. The bottom and the inner skirt is a uthen coated polyester and therefore it is taped. :)

    It's not possible to seamtape silnylon..
    The only thing sticking to silicone is silicone. If the producer was to seal every seam wirh silicone the tent would be a lot more expensive.
